STMicroelectronics 74VHC02TTR Quad 2-Input NOR Gate
The 74VHC02TTR from STMicroelectronics is a high-speed CMOS quad 2-input NOR gate integrated circuit. This device is designed to deliver the same performance as the equivalent bipolar Schottky TTL while significantly reducing power consumption. The 74VHC02TTR is part of STMicroelectronics' VHC family, known for its versatility and reliability in a wide range of digital applications.
Key Features:
- Logic Type: NOR Gate
- Number of Circuits: 4
- Inputs per Circuit: 2
- Operating Voltage Range: 2V to 5.5V
- High-Speed Performance: tPD 4.1ns at 5V
- Low Power Dissipation: Icc 2µA (max) at 25°C
- Output Current: ±8mA
- Operating Temperature Range: -55°C to +125°C
- Package: TSSOP14
The 74VHC02TTR is available in a TSSOP14 (Thin Shrink Small Outline Package) which is suitable for surface-mount technology, making it ideal for compact and high-density electronic assemblies. The device's logic gates are capable of driving 50Ω transmission lines, making them suitable for interfacing with high-speed signal lines.
With its wide operating voltage range, the 74VHC02TTR can be used in systems that require 3.3V or 5V logic levels, providing designers with flexibility in their circuit designs. The low power dissipation and high noise immunity of the CMOS process ensure that this device is suitable for battery-operated and low-power applications as well as for use in more demanding environments.
